摘要
Burst repetition spreading is a well known method for signal spreading in satellite communication systems. Frequency offsets cause a rotation in the repetition symbols, thus in the de-spreading process the repetitions are coherently combined by correcting their phase rotation. However, in low SNR conditions, conventional methods for phase offset estimation result in a large combining loss. In this paper, we developed a novel approximate Maximum Likelihood estimator for the repetition phase offset, and also show an efficient implementation of the estimator. Simulation results show that the combining loss of the developed estimator is significantly smaller than the combining loss of the conventional de-spreading method in low SNR conditions.
